best hotels in tampa – Hotels in Tampa come in all shapes and sizes. So whether you’re looking for a luxury oceanfront resort to celebrate a romantic anniversary or a suite near Busch Gardens big enough to accommodate the family, there’s a hotel in this Gulf Coast metropolis. And while the Tampa Bay metropolitan area is expanding, most of the major attractions and lodging options are concentrated in a few central areas.
The center is an area. You’ll find a variety of accommodations here, from budget motels to 4-star hotels, museums, restaurants, entertainment venues, and the Tampa Riverwalk. More hotels are located in the historic and culturally rich areas of Ybor City and Hyde Park North, also home to excellent dining options.
The neighborhood near Raymond James Stadium in northwest Tampa, where the Buccaneers play NFL football, is also home to some fantastic luxury hotels. This area is also close to the airport if you need to catch an early flight.
Heading north of downtown, you’ll find more hotels around Busch Gardens, an African-themed amusement park revered by families for its mix of safari adventures and roller coasters. Check out this list of our favorite hotels in the Tampa Bay area for all budgets.

Summary
The 244-room Westin Tampa Bay is an upscale beach hotel on Rocky Point Island and near the airport. Stylish, sunny rooms feature minibars, iPod docks, coffeemakers with Starbucks coffee, and modern bathrooms with walk-in rainfall showers and soaking tubs. Some rooms offer splendid ocean views, kitchenettes, exercise equipment, and a complimentary continental breakfast. The hotel’s Aqua restaurant serves seafood in a stylish space, and there’s a Starbucks. The beach is small and gets road noise, but there’s a lovely indoor pool, hot tub, and a modern 24-hour fitness center. Business travelers are well catered for with ample meeting rooms, event space, and a 24/7 business center. Wi-Fi is free in public areas, but in-room Wi-Fi is charged for non-SPG members, as is parking. There are several comparable hotels in the area, such as the Embassy Suites Hotel Tampa Bay, so travelers may want to compare rates.

Grand Hyatt Tampa Bay
It’s rare to find a city with one of the best hotels near the airport, but Tampa Bay is one of those metropolitan areas. Located on a 35-acre nature reserve, the waterfront Grand Hyatt Tampa Bay is one of the city’s best luxury hotels and is close to the airport and Raymond James Stadium.
The 4-star, 4-diamond property is a unique destination retreat with a mix of contemporary and comfortable rooms and elegant private casitas. We like the latter for romantic getaways as they are more intimate and surrounded by mangroves.
For amenities, you’ll find a couple of pools, Tennis courts, a 24-hour gym, a nature trail, a man-made beach with sun loungers, a fire pit, and ping-pong tables. Meals are also a breeze thanks to the hotel’s three restaurants: try the Oystercatchers for seafood at a table facing the bay.

Florida Palace Hotel
The Floridan Palace is a popular romantic option for couples in the heart of downtown. In a building dating back to the golden age of the 1920s, the hotel has maintained its original grandeur for the past 90 years and is one of the few hotels in Tampa Bay to be list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
The spacious and opulent rooms retain the traditional Beaux Arts style, with layers of gold and antique wooden furniture. The restaurant also has the original ceiling from 1926 and serves a delicious Mediterranean menu.

Le Meridien Tampa
The interior design of Le Meridien Tampa is the hotel’s best attribute downtown. Inside a former federal courthouse, the location is ideal for accessing many of Tampa Bay’s top attractions, meaning once you get out of the immediate neighborhood, it can feel a bit gritty.
The hotel transformation has preserved many of the original courthouse details, including a sign pointing to the judge’s chambers, marble columns, and historic light fixtures. However, the rooms and suites have a more modern look and are clean and comfortable. There is also a French restaurant on site serving fresh seafood.
